The photograph captures a captivating scene of the Fagradalsfjall volcano in Iceland erupting on June 2nd, 2021. The volcano stands tall in the background, with plumes of billowing ash and steam rising into the sky. Lava flows out of the crater and cascades down the slopes of the volcano in mesmerizing rivers of molten red and orange. The glowing lava creates a stark contrast against the dark volcanic rock and is reflected in the clouds above showcasing the raw power and beauty of nature. This spectacle of nature is further highlighted by the people standing on the hill to the rights side of the photo and how they are dwarfed by the eruption in front of them
